Bilas:
"It is generally true that the best teams are consistent, something most people instinctively understand. Good teams are those that take care of business and don't have lapses that get our ESPN analysts questioning their heart or toughness. This instinct shows up in the numbers, too. Among the top 75 teams in BPI, the seven most consistent are also the top seven teams in our rankings. Compared to Kentucky's 4.9 variation, though, only Syracuse's 5.8 variation is close, with the others having values between 9 and 10. Kansas, Ohio State, Michigan State, North Carolina and Duke all have had either a really bad loss or several mediocre games. "
